https://reporter.zp.ua

PSoC

# ,

Редактор: Михайло Мельник

Ви можете поставити запитання спеціалісту!

PSoC: Програмована система на чипі, що перевершує межі традиційних мікроконтролерів

У сучасному світі інтегральних схем, де мініатюризація та універсальність відіграють ключову роль, програмовані системи на чипі (PSoC) виходять на перший план. Розроблені компанією Cypress Semiconductor, PSoC є новаторськими пристроями, що вміщують на одному чипі не лише процесорне ядро, а й матрицю цифрових та аналогових блоків. Завдяки цим особливостям, PSoC відкривають широкі можливості для розробки складних вбудованих систем, що поєднують в собі аналогову та цифрову обробку сигналів. Ця стаття досліджує архітектуру, можливості та застосування PSoC, демонструючи їх перевагу над традиційними мікроконтролерами.

Архітектура PSoC: Проникнення в серце універсальності

PSoC вирізняються унікальною архітектурою, що складається з чотирьох основних компонентів:

• Процесорне ядро: Серцем PSoC є малопотужне процесорне ядро ARM Cortex-M0+ або ARM Cortex-M4, відповідальне за виконання коду програми.

• Конфігуровані аналогові та цифрові блоки: Ця матриця блоків дозволяє розробникам створювати власні периферійні пристрої, такі як АЦП, ЦАП, компаратори, фільтри та таймери, без необхідності додаткових компонентів.

• Програмований інтерфейс вводу-виводу (PIO): PIO забезпечує гнучкість у підключенні зовнішніх пристроїв та периферійних компонентів до PSoC.

• Пам’ять: PSoC мають як оперативну пам’ять (ОЗП), так і флеш-пам’ять, що забезпечує зберігання програмного коду та даних.

PSoC vs. Традиційні мікроконтролери: Переосмислення інтеграції

У порівнянні з традиційними мікроконтролерами, PSoC пропонують ряд переваг:

• Інтеграція: PSoC об’єднують функціональні компоненти, які зазвичай вимагали б окремих мікросхем, що призводить до мініатюризації, зниження вартості та спрощення розробки.

• Гнучкість: Конфігуровані аналогові та цифрові блоки PSoC надають розробникам свободу створювати власні периферійні пристрої, адаптуючись до специфічних потреб проекту.

• Енергоефективність: PSoC відомі своїми низькими енергоспоживанням, роблячи їх ідеальними для портативних та малопотужних пристроїв.

• Універсальність: PSoC підтримують різноманітні програмні платформи та інструменти розробки, що спрощує перехід від одного проекту до іншого.

PSoC Creator: Настроюване середовище розробки

Cypress Semiconductor надає безкоштовне середовище розробки PSoC Creator, що дозволяє розробникам створювати, конфігурувати та програмувати PSoC. PSoC Creator пропонує:

• Графічний інтерфейс: Інтуїтивно зрозумілий інтерфейс спрощує процес створення проектів, розробки програмного коду та налаштування периферійних пристроїв.

Є питання? Запитай в чаті зі штучним інтелектом!

• Бібліотеки периферійних пристроїв: PSoC Creator включає в себе бібліотеки, що містять готові компоненти та функціональні блоки, які можна безпосередньо використовувати в проектах.

• Гнучкість кодування: Розробники можуть використовувати мови програмування C або Assembly для створення програмного коду, що забезпечує високий рівень контролю та оптимізації.

• Відладка: PSoC Creator має вбудований відладчик, що дозволяє розробникам відстежувати виконання програмного коду та виявляти помилки в реальному часі.

Застосування PSoC: Безмежні можливості для інновацій

PSoC знайшли застосування в широкому спектрі галузей та сфер:

• Промисловість: PSoC використовуються в системах управління двигунами, сенсорних мережах та пристроях автоматизації.

• Медицина: PSoC застосовуються в портативних пристроях моніторингу здоров’я, фітнес-трекерах та медичних датчиках.

• Потребительская електроніка: PSoC використовуються в смартфонах, планшетах, ноутбуках та інших портативних пристроях.

• Автомобільна промисловість: PSoC застосовуються в системах контролю двигуна, управління світлотехнікою та системах безпеки.

• Розвиток IoT: PSoC є ключовими компонентами у пристроях Інтернету речей (IoT), забезпечуючи зв’язок, обробку даних та незалежне функціонування.

PSoC: Епоха уніфікованої електроніки

PSoC революціонізували світ вбудованих систем, надаючи розробникам універсальне рішення для створення складних, інтегрованих пристроїв. Завдяки своїй гнучкій архітектурі, енергоефективності та підтримці різноманітних застосувань, PSoC стали незамінним інструментом у широкому спектрі галузей. Зростаюча популярність PSoC свідчить про їх здатність змінювати обличчя електроніки, відкриваючи нові горизонти для інновацій та творчості.

Висновок:

PSoC, як програмовані системи на чипі, представляють епоху уніфікованої електроніки. Об’єднуючи в собі процесорне ядро, конфігуровані аналогові та цифрові блоки, а також доступність середовища розробки PSoC Creator, ці пристрої забезпечують універсальність, гнучкість та спрощення розробки. PSoC знаходять застосування в широкому спектрі галузей, від промисловості до медицини та автомобільної промисловості, дозволяючи розробникам створювати складні, інтегровані пристрої. Зростаюча популярність PSoC свідчить про їх здатність змінити світ інтегральних схем, прокладаючи шлях до нових інновацій та творчих рішень.

Запитання, що часто задаються:

1. Які основні компоненти архітектури PSoC?
2. Які переваги PSoC у порівнянні з традиційними мікроконтролерами?
3. Що таке PSoC Creator та які можливості він надає розробникам?
4. Наведіть кілька прикладів застосування PSoC у різних галузях.
5. Які перспективи розвитку PSoC та як вони впливають на майбутнє електроніки?

У вас є запитання чи ви хочете поділитися своєю думкою? Тоді запрошуємо написати їх в коментарях!

У вас є запитання до змісту чи автора статті?
НАПИСАТИ

Залишити коментар

Опубліковано на 02 01 2024. Поданий під Вікі. Ви можете слідкувати за будь-якими відповідями через RSS 2.0. Ви можете подивитись до кінця і залишити відповідь.

ХОЧЕТЕ СТАТИ АВТОРОМ?

Запропонуйте свої послуги за цим посиланням.
Контакти :: Редакція
Використання будь-яких матеріалів, розміщених на сайті, дозволяється за умови посилання на Reporter.zp.ua.
Редакція не несе відповідальності за матеріали, розміщені користувачами та які помічені "реклама".